Calculus-based electricity and magnetism
Know the structure before you walk in.
35 questions, 45 minutes, 50% of score.
Tests electrostatics, circuits, magnetism, and electromagnetism.
3 questions, 45 minutes, 50% of score.
Requires calculus-based derivations and problem solving.
Graphing calculator required.
Equation sheet provided. Total time: 1 hour 30 minutes.
Approximately 33% of students score a 5.
Scores of 3+ typically earn college credit.
